Debian Debian-France Debian-Facile Debian-fr.org Debian-fr.xyz Debian ? Communautés

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#26 16-08-2021 13:00:48

raleur
Membre
Inscription : 03-10-2014

Re : [RESOLU] Linux et le format exFAT

La documentation de Gparted indique effectivement qu'il faut le paquet exfatprogs pour qu'il puisse formater en exFAT. Ça aurait été sympa de marquer cette dépendance dans les "Suggests" du paquet gparted.
Les paquets exfatprogs et exfat-utils fournissent tous les deux un programme mkfs.exfat mais avec des options incompatibles (c'est malin...) donc si Gparted essaie d'utiliser mkfs.exfat de exfat-utils avec des options spécifiques à la version de exfatprogs, ça ne marchera pas.

Dernière modification par raleur (16-08-2021 13:06:16)


Il vaut mieux montrer que raconter.

Hors ligne

#27 16-08-2021 19:52:26

Debeee
Membre
Distrib. : Buster / Testing
Noyau : 4.19.0-8 / 5.4.0-4
(G)UI : mate /mate
Inscription : 11-02-2015

Re : [RESOLU] Linux et le format exFAT

raleur a écrit :

Ça aurait été sympa de marquer cette dépendance dans les "Suggests" du paquet gparted


Oui. Et aussi, ça aurait été sympa de griser l'option exfat du menu de formatage (il y a d'autres options qui sont inaccessibles) au lieu de donner juste un message d'erreur après une opération ratée qui laisse le disque en vrac (j'ai testé avec une clé usb, elle ne s'affiche plus sur le bureau ni dans caja quand on la rebranche après le formatage exfat raté ; elle reste visible par Gparted, on peut la reformater différemment)
Si on regarde le message d'erreur en détail, il dit : mkfs.exfat -L : invalid option --'L' (mkexfatfs 1.3.0)

A noter que j'ai eu ce comportement avec une mise à jour d'une version 10, il serait intéressant de savoir quels sont les paquets chargés sur une version 11 fraîchement installée, y compris quand on installe Gparted : si quelqu'un dans ce cas pouvait faire un retour d'expérience...
J'ai assez peu d'espoir, j'ai une autre machine que je viens juste d'upgrader en v11, sur laquelle je n'avais pas Gparted d'installé. Quand je l'ai installé, Synaptic ne m'a pas proposé de charger exfatprogs.

raleur a écrit :

Les paquets exfatprogs et exfat-utils fournissent tous les deux un programme mkfs.exfat mais avec des options incompatibles (c'est malin...) donc si Gparted essaie d'utiliser mkfs.exfat de exfat-utils avec des options spécifiques à la version de exfatprogs, ça ne marchera pas.


J'ai flairé que 2 softs concurrents pour faire la même chose ça ne pouvait apporter que des ennuis, c'est pour ça que j'ai supprimé exfat-utils et exfat-fuse  de ma config : à l'ordre 0 ça marche, le noyau prend bien les choses en main, un disque exfat est reconnu, il monte, on peut lire et écrire dessus. Maintenant, je ne prétends pas avoir fait une validation poussée.
Quelle est ta préconisation : désinstaller ces deux paquets pour éviter les interférence, ou est-ce qu'il y a des cas pointus où ils peuvent avoir une utilité ?

Hors ligne

#28 16-08-2021 22:18:56

raleur
Membre
Inscription : 03-10-2014

Re : [RESOLU] Linux et le format exFAT

Debeee a écrit :

ça aurait été sympa de griser l'option exfat du menu de formatage (il y a d'autres options qui sont inaccessibles) au lieu de donner juste un message d'erreur après une opération ratée


Et comment il fait pour savoir que la version de mkfs.exfat présente n'est pas la bonne sans essayer de l'utiliser ?

Debeee a écrit :

après une opération ratée qui laisse le disque en vrac (j'ai testé avec une clé usb, elle ne s'affiche plus sur le bureau ni dans caja quand on la rebranche après le formatage exfat raté


Si gparted fait un "wipefs" pour effacer les méta-données existantes avant d'essayer de formater, le volume ne contient plus de système de fichiers et c'est normal qu'un gestionnaire de fichiers ne l'affiche pas.

Debeee a écrit :

Si on regarde le message d'erreur en détail, il dit : mkfs.exfat -L : invalid option --'L' (mkexfatfs 1.3.0)


Ben oui, pas la bonne version de mkfs.exfat, donc option non supportée comme je l'ai écrit en #26.

Dernière modification par raleur (16-08-2021 22:19:43)


Il vaut mieux montrer que raconter.

Hors ligne

#29 16-08-2021 22:51:23

Debeee
Membre
Distrib. : Buster / Testing
Noyau : 4.19.0-8 / 5.4.0-4
(G)UI : mate /mate
Inscription : 11-02-2015

Re : [RESOLU] Linux et le format exFAT

raleur a écrit :

Et comment il fait pour savoir que la version de mkfs.exfat présente n'est pas la bonne sans essayer de l'utiliser ?


D'après mes manips (et ce que tu dis en #26), Gparted ne sait pas formater en exfat sans le paquet exfatprogs : si ce paquet n'est pas installé, Gparted ne devrait pas avoir l'option exfat accessible, point.

Hors ligne

#30 16-08-2021 22:58:05

raleur
Membre
Inscription : 03-10-2014

Re : [RESOLU] Linux et le format exFAT

Sauf que gparted ne vérifie pas la présence du paquet exfatprogs mais du programme mkfs.exfat dont une variante incompatible peut être fournie par le paquet exfat-utils, et visiblement il ne sait pas les différencier.

Dernière modification par raleur (16-08-2021 23:00:36)


Il vaut mieux montrer que raconter.

Hors ligne

Pied de page des forums